    I was born in 1979, so I was a little girl in the 80s. There was definitely fashion for little girls. What I remember was matching sets. Most days I wore a matching skirt & t shirt or shorts & t-shirt. Very sought after was Fido Dido wear, which of course came in loads of matching sets & overalls. Overalls were a thing, neon, leg warmers, in Australia it was cool go wear Dunlop sneakers with no laces, but Reeboks were HUGE. Perms of course, I got my first perm in grade six. I was the first girl in my whole school to get an undercut which was in 1989. Bright makeup, like blue eyshadow was popular. I didn't really have any control over my style, my mum didn't let me pick my own clothes most of the time, but big t shirts over shorts were in & my mum was very happy to buy me those, phew. She was also ok buying me the aerobics gear that was really popular. I had so many neon bike pants to wear with my oversize t-shirt. Think the Pump up the Jam & Ring my Bell videoclips. I had skinny acid wash jeans & I wore to death. They had gold zips at the ankles.

    I graduated hs is 85. College in 89. Blush: With Dynasty being huge, everyone wore their blush almost like a straight line up to accent their cheekbones. When I started to wear blush when I was 13, it was probably Cover Girl. A soft pink blush. When I was a little older, I splurged and got the Clinique blush in the iconic Apple blue packaging. The first look with the absolutely bright print sweater and tights, reminds me of Heather’s the original cult classic movie. I highly suggest you reach for Heather’s for inspiration. Your eyeglasses would’ve been red in the 80s like Sally Jesse Raphael. I had a pair to read the blackboard. High top Reeboks would’ve been red too. White was really saved for regular sneakers. Nike was huge! I remember leather white Nikes with bold colored swooshes. Major status symbol in the very late 70s to early 80s. Your mom is right about the polka dots. Around 83 there was a major 50s influence. Black and white bold bigger polka dot skirts ruled. Saddle shoes were back in. GAP was breaking out big time! I dressed in mostly GAP. Late early 80s were Sasson & Jordache mostly. I had a pair or two. And Gloria Vanderbilt was huge. Unfortunately, skinny tall flat Brooke Shields’s Calvin Klein, “Nothing comes between me & my Calvin’s,” ads were all over the place: commercials, in EVERY woman’s magazine, and billboards. They were a horrible influence on girls growing up. Attempting to “be” remotely like her was impossible for every girl. Honestly, I believe this campaign created eating disorders. Teachers did not have the money to wear fancy print blouses to school. They dressed down. My mom was a businesswoman & these were a staple in her wardrobe. For inspiration on upscale looks for teens check out the ESPRIT catalogues. I had some pieces I was fortunate to buy at the original Filene’s Basement in downtown Boston. I remember buying a pair of bright roomy shorts on sale at Bloomingdale’s. But I never bought anything from the catalogs I drooled over. Benetton sweaters became huge in the late 80s. My straight younger brother borrowed my maroon argyle one. It was women’s but was completely unisex. You couldn’t tell it was for women. Benetton sweaters were made in Italy. Phenomenally made. They were pretty expensive, but if you had a job during hs, a great investment. I had several in the 90s. The heavy ones are built like iron! I just purchased a couple on EBay. I live in NE & it gets cold. I dressed kinda preppy. These clothes are fitted. For the beginning of hs my mom took me shopping @ Hit or Miss & bought me a new wardrobe. I joined swim team fall of my freshman year, and NONE of the blouses fit. I was stronger and broader. The skirts & pants still fit. I was 14 & babysitting was how I made money, my mom had to buy me new clothes on sale, or at Marshalls or Filene’s Basement. Lacoste was huge for preppy clothes. They were a status symbol with a sweater tied around the neck for both boys/M & girls/W.
